With the regular season over, the Associated Press has announced its honorees from the SEC.

Among the awards given out on Tuesday morning were Coach of the Year, Player of the Year, first- and second-team All-SEC and Newcomer of the Year.

For the second year in a row, Tennessee F Grant Williams is the best player in the conference, while Ole Miss coach Kermit Davis takes home Coach of the Year honors in his first year at the helm for the Rebels.

Here’s a look at this year’s honorees:

Player of the Year: Grant Williams, F, Tennessee

Coach of the Year: Kermit Davis, Ole Miss

First-team All-SEC

  • Grant Williams, F, Tennessee
  • Daniel Gafford, F, Arkansas
  • PJ Washington, F, Kentucky
  • Tremont Waters, G, LSU
  • Quinndary Weatherspoon, G, Mississippi State

Second-team All-SEC

  • Jordan Bone, G, Tennessee
  • Jared Harper, G, Auburn
  • Breein Tyree, G, Ole Miss
  • Admiral Schofield, G/F, Tennessee
  • Chris Silva, F, South Carolina

Newcomer of the Year: Tyler Herro, G, Kentucky
